A distinguished pianist and academic, recognition came from performances of classical repertoire, including interpretations of works by Chopin, Liszt, and Beethoven. Participation in various music festivals highlighted immense talent, alongside a commitment to music education. Teaching roles at renowned institutions contributed to shaping the next generation of musicians. Additionally, recordings of concertos and solo compositions added to a prolific career in both performance and scholarship.

This individual played as a relief pitcher in Major League Baseball, primarily for the Detroit Tigers. A significant achievement includes being awarded the 1984 American League Cy Young Award and the Most Valuable Player Award in the World Series that same year. Contributed to the Tigers' victory in the 1984 World Series. Also played for the Chicago Cubs and the Philadelphia Phillies during a career that spanned from 1977 to 1990.

Graduated from the University of Oklahoma with a degree in aeronautical engineering. Served as a fighter pilot in the U.S. Air Force before joining NASA. Participated in the Apollo 13 mission in 1970, which was intended to land on the Moon but was aborted due to an in-flight emergency. The mission showcased extensive problem-solving and engineering skills to ensure the safe return of the crew. Also worked on the Space Shuttle program as a project manager.
